随机变量在自然语言处理中的应用(2)

1.引言

随机变量是概率论中的重要概念,其在自然语言处理中也有广泛应用。本文将以**词作为随机变量为例,探讨随机变量在自然语言处理中的应用。

2.**词的定义

**词指在一个句子中起到“核心作用”的词,通常是名词、动词或形容词。**词是句子的重要组成部分,也是语义信息的关键表达。

3.随机变量的定义

随机变量指在一组随机试验中,可能出现不同取值的变量。在自然语言处理中,我们可以将**词作为随机变量,其取值包括词汇表中的所有单词。

4.**词作为随机变量的应用

4.1 语言建模

语言建模是自然语言处理中的一个基本问题,其目的是根据语料库中的文本预测下一个词出现的概率。随机变量可以帮助我们解决这个问题,通过计算**词在语料库中出现的**,我们可以得到该词的概率分布,进而计算出整个句子的概率。

4.2 词嵌入

词嵌入是将词汇表中的单词映射到低维向量空间中的过程。通过将**词作为随机变量,我们可以得到该词的分布情况,进而计算出单词之间的相似度。这种方法在许多自然语言处理任务中都得到了广泛应用,比如文本分类、问答系统等。

4.3 语义分析

语义分析是自然语言处理中的另一个重要问题,其目的是抽取出句子中的语义信息。通过将**词作为随机变量,我们可以计算出该词的上下文信息,比如词性、词义、情感等。这种方法在文本情感分析、命名实体识别等任务中都得到了广泛应用。

5.总结

随机变量在自然语言处理中有着广泛的应用,其中以**词作为随机变量最为常见。通过将**词作为随机变量,我们可以获得句子中的语义信息,进而解决许多自然语言处理中的问题。

标签:
上一篇2023-07-13
下一篇 2023-07-13

相关推荐